/external/clang/lib/CodeGen/ |
D | CGCleanup.h | 234 struct ExtInfo &getExtInfo() { in getExtInfo() function 239 const struct ExtInfo &getExtInfo() const { in getExtInfo() function 332 struct ExtInfo &ExtInfo = getExtInfo(); in addBranchAfter() 368 return getExtInfo().Branches.insert(Block); in addBranchThrough()
|
D | CGCall.h | 242 FunctionType::ExtInfo getExtInfo() const { in getExtInfo() function
|
D | CGCall.cpp | 81 FTNP->getExtInfo(), in arrangeFreeFunctionType() 105 return arrangeLLVMFunctionInfo(CGT, prefix, FTP, FTP->getExtInfo()); in arrangeFreeFunctionType() 124 FunctionType::ExtInfo extInfo = FTP->getExtInfo(); in arrangeCXXMethodType() 217 FunctionType::ExtInfo extInfo = FTP->getExtInfo(); in arrangeCXXConstructorDeclaration() 238 FunctionType::ExtInfo extInfo = FTP->getExtInfo(); in arrangeCXXDestructor() 262 noProto->getExtInfo(), in arrangeFunctionDeclaration() 353 fnType->getExtInfo(), required); in arrangeFreeFunctionLikeCall() 399 FunctionType::ExtInfo info = FPT->getExtInfo(); in arrangeCXXMethodCall()
|
D | CGObjCRuntime.cpp | 364 FunctionType::ExtInfo einfo = signature.getExtInfo(); in getMessageSendInfo()
|
D | CGBlocks.cpp | 1114 fnType->getExtInfo(), in GenerateBlockFunction()
|
/external/clang/include/clang/AST/ |
D | Decl.h | 515 ExtInfo *getExtInfo() { return DeclInfo.get<ExtInfo*>(); } in getExtInfo() function 516 const ExtInfo *getExtInfo() const { return DeclInfo.get<ExtInfo*>(); } in getExtInfo() function 528 ? getExtInfo()->TInfo in getTypeSourceInfo() 533 getExtInfo()->TInfo = TI; in setTypeSourceInfo() 555 return hasExtInfo() ? getExtInfo()->QualifierLoc.getNestedNameSpecifier() in getQualifier() 563 return hasExtInfo() ? getExtInfo()->QualifierLoc in getQualifierLoc() 570 return hasExtInfo() ? getExtInfo()->NumTemplParamLists : 0; in getNumTemplateParameterLists() 574 return getExtInfo()->TemplParamLists[index]; in getTemplateParameterList() 2439 ExtInfo *getExtInfo() { return TypedefNameDeclOrQualifier.get<ExtInfo*>(); } in getExtInfo() function 2440 const ExtInfo *getExtInfo() const { in getExtInfo() function [all …]
|
D | CanonicalType.h | 548 LLVM_CLANG_CANPROXY_SIMPLE_ACCESSOR(FunctionType::ExtInfo, getExtInfo) 555 LLVM_CLANG_CANPROXY_SIMPLE_ACCESSOR(FunctionType::ExtInfo, getExtInfo) 562 LLVM_CLANG_CANPROXY_SIMPLE_ACCESSOR(FunctionType::ExtInfo, getExtInfo)
|
D | Type.h | 2702 bool getHasRegParm() const { return getExtInfo().getHasRegParm(); } 2703 unsigned getRegParmType() const { return getExtInfo().getRegParm(); } 2707 bool getNoReturnAttr() const { return getExtInfo().getNoReturn(); } 2708 CallingConv getCallConv() const { return getExtInfo().getCC(); } 2709 ExtInfo getExtInfo() const { return ExtInfo(FunctionTypeBits.ExtInfo); } 2746 Profile(ID, getResultType(), getExtInfo()); 2872 EPI.ExtInfo = getExtInfo(); 4672 return FT->getExtInfo(); 4674 return FT->getExtInfo();
|
/external/clang/lib/AST/ |
D | Decl.cpp | 1335 getExtInfo()->TInfo = savedTInfo; in setQualifierInfo() 1338 getExtInfo()->QualifierLoc = QualifierLoc; in setQualifierInfo() 1342 if (getExtInfo()->NumTemplParamLists == 0) { in setQualifierInfo() 1344 TypeSourceInfo *savedTInfo = getExtInfo()->TInfo; in setQualifierInfo() 1346 getASTContext().Deallocate(getExtInfo()); in setQualifierInfo() 1351 getExtInfo()->QualifierLoc = QualifierLoc; in setQualifierInfo() 1368 getExtInfo()->TInfo = savedTInfo; in setTemplateParameterListsInfo() 1371 getExtInfo()->setTemplateParameterListsInfo(Context, NumTPLists, TPLists); in setTemplateParameterListsInfo() 2913 getExtInfo()->QualifierLoc = QualifierLoc; in setQualifierInfo() 2917 if (getExtInfo()->NumTemplParamLists == 0) { in setQualifierInfo() [all …]
|
D | TypePrinter.cpp | 623 FunctionType::ExtInfo Info = T->getExtInfo(); in printFunctionProtoAfter()
|
D | ASTImporter.cpp | 563 if (Function1->getExtInfo() != Function2->getExtInfo()) in IsStructurallyEquivalent() 1574 T->getExtInfo()); in VisitFunctionNoProtoType()
|
D | ASTContext.cpp | 1967 if (T->getExtInfo() == Info) in adjustFunctionType() 6722 FunctionType::ExtInfo lbaseInfo = lbase->getExtInfo(); in mergeFunctionTypes() 6723 FunctionType::ExtInfo rbaseInfo = rbase->getExtInfo(); in mergeFunctionTypes()
|
/external/clang/lib/Sema/ |
D | SemaType.cpp | 4019 FunctionType::ExtInfo EI = unwrapped.get()->getExtInfo().withNoReturn(true); in handleFunctionTypeAttr() 4036 = unwrapped.get()->getExtInfo().withProducesResult(true); in handleFunctionTypeAttr() 4062 unwrapped.get()->getExtInfo().withRegParm(value); in handleFunctionTypeAttr() 4079 FunctionType::ExtInfo EI= unwrapped.get()->getExtInfo().withCallingConv(CC); in handleFunctionTypeAttr() 4120 FunctionType::ExtInfo EI = unwrapped.get()->getExtInfo().withCallingConv(CC); in handleFunctionTypeAttr()
|
D | SemaTemplateInstantiateDecl.cpp | 1087 if (OrigFunc->getExtInfo() == NewFunc->getExtInfo()) in adjustFunctionTypeForInstantiation() 1091 NewEPI.ExtInfo = OrigFunc->getExtInfo(); in adjustFunctionTypeForInstantiation()
|
D | SemaOverload.cpp | 1345 FunctionType::ExtInfo EInfo = FromFn->getExtInfo(); in IsNoReturnConversion() 2439 FunctionType::ExtInfo FromEInfo = FromFunctionType->getExtInfo(); in IsBlockPointerConversion() 2440 FunctionType::ExtInfo ToEInfo = ToFunctionType->getExtInfo(); in IsBlockPointerConversion()
|
D | SemaDecl.cpp | 2340 FunctionType::ExtInfo OldTypeInfo = OldType->getExtInfo(); in MergeFunctionDecl() 2341 FunctionType::ExtInfo NewTypeInfo = NewType->getExtInfo(); in MergeFunctionDecl() 6472 EPI.ExtInfo = FT->getExtInfo(); in ActOnFunctionDeclarator()
|
D | SemaExpr.cpp | 2555 fty->getExtInfo()); in BuildDeclarationNameExpr() 9661 FunctionType::ExtInfo Ext = FTy->getExtInfo(); in ActOnBlockStmtExpr() 11859 FnType->getExtInfo()); in VisitCallExpr()
|
D | SemaExprCXX.cpp | 4639 ReturnsRetained = FTy->getExtInfo().getProducesResult(); in MaybeBindToTemporary()
|
/external/clang/lib/Serialization/ |
D | ASTWriterDecl.cpp | 220 Writer.AddQualifierInfo(*D->getExtInfo(), Record); in VisitTagDecl() 307 Writer.AddQualifierInfo(*D->getExtInfo(), Record); in VisitDeclaratorDecl()
|
D | ASTWriter.cpp | 172 FunctionType::ExtInfo C = T->getExtInfo(); in VisitFunctionType()
|